Youth Services provides comprehensive programming for all Port Gamble S’Klallam community youth, guiding them to become healthy adults who make a positive contribution to the community. Youth Services provides a variety of opportunities to community youth, emphasizing S’Klallam culture and traditions, healthy lifestyles, positive decision-making, mentorship, and life skills that build leadership.

Youth Services Strategic Plan goals include initiatives to increase:

  • Youth participation in cultural activities
  • Positive relationships between youth and adults
  • Youth and Elder relationships and interactions
  • Opportunities for youth to gain work experience
  • Opportunities for youth to give back to the community
  • Opportunities that allow youth to plan for their futures

 

Programs/services offered:

  • Programming for youth in grades 4th-12th grade
  • Extra-Curricular Scholarships for Preschool-12th grade
  • Driver’s Education Scholarship Assistance
  • Young Adult Programing
  • Community and Youth Prevention
  • Chi-e-chee ATOD Coalition
